WebMar 2, 2024 · The diaphragm is a nice, big dome-shaped muscle that sits beneath the rib cage, separating the thoracic and abdominopelvic cavities. In addition to your abdominal muscles and those tiny muscles between the ribs, the diaphragm helps you breath. Because of its position and size, it is your most efficient breathing muscle. In the breathing chapter (Chapter 2) it was discussed how the diaphragm and pelvic floor work in tandem—they lower during inspiration and rise during expiration.

WebSep 2, 2015 · The diaphragm and the pelvic floor are bound together structurally and functionally by both fascial and muscular connections (Chaitow 2012).
